Product Introduction
This is a metallic multifunctional USB-C docking station, which can extend the USB-C port on your laptop. It offers multiple ports including HDMI, VGA, Audio/Mic, DP, USB-C, Ethernet, USB 3.0, and SD&TF Card Reader, along with USB-C female PD charge capability.

Features
- PD 3.0: Supports 100W power input; charging is limited to 87-96W for safety, which may be affected by different firmware.
- DP: Supports 4Kx2K @60Hz (3840x2160) when the source is DP1.4, and 4Kx2K @30Hz (3840x2160) when the source is DP1.2. It supports 4Kx2K @30Hz when HDMI & DP work simultaneously. DP output will be 1080P when HDMI, VGA & DP work simultaneously.
- HDMI: Supports 4Kx2K @60Hz (3840x2160), backward compatible with 1080P, 1080i, and 720P. HDMI output will be 1080P when HDMI & VGA work simultaneously, and also when HDMI, VGA & DP work simultaneously.
- VGA: Supports 1080P @60Hz.
- Max Ethernet Speed: 1000M.
- USB 3.0: Provides 5Gb/s data transfer speed, backward compatible with USB 2.0, and offers power supply up to 4.5W Max.
- SD/TF Card Reader: Supports read speeds of 50 - 104MB/s and write speeds of 30 - 40MB/s, which may be affected by card quality.
- USB-C 3.0: Supports data transfer at 5Gbps and downstream charging at 5V/0.9A@4.5W.
- 3.5mm Audio/Mic: Supports audio and microphone input/output.

Notes
- The USB-C source devices (mobile/notebook/tablet PC) must support video output.
- The USB-C source devices (mobile/notebook/tablet PC) must support OTG (On-The-Go).
- Maintaining a solid connection and supplying adequate working current is recommended.
FAQs
a. Why is there no video output?
- 1. Please ensure the connection is secure.
- 2. Please use a standard HDMI cable.
b. Why is there no audio output from the HDMI port?
- 1. Please verify that the monitor has an audio output function.
- 2. Please set the external monitor as the default audio output device in your system settings.
